ZIP 49971 and ZIP 50001 are ZIP Code areas in Michigan and Iowa respectively. This page compares them across population, income, housing, education, commuting, and how each has changed since 2019.

ZIP 50001 has the higher population (626 vs 404 in ZIP 49971). ZIP 50001 has the higher median household income ($131,350 vs $39,792 in ZIP 49971). ZIP 50001 has the higher median home value ($352,300 vs $59,700 in ZIP 49971).
